1) Social Media Signals
It is no secret that Google, Bing, and other search engines make use of online conversation as part of their ranking algorithms. Whenever people tweet, like, comment or share a piece of content This is referred to as social engagement. The more social engagements a piece of content receives, the more social signals you can build for your website. These social signals are used by search engines to determine the quality of the content. This allows search engines to identify what people find most useful and what their algorithm deems as high-quality. If a piece of content receives a lot of social shares it will be immediately classified.

2.) Link Building
It's long gone of going out and soliciting websites to add links to your site. Google's Panda/Penguin algorithms have forced SEOs to link build the traditional way: create good quality content that is pertinent. How do you reach out to websites who are willing to link to your content, when asking them directly would be thought to be "unnatural"? Social media is your solution. Social media allows you to expose your content to of relevant audiences that may be in a position to influence them to link to your content if it's worth linking to. People who share your content with others, increasing your influence.

3.) Content Amplification
You can create all the good-quality content that you wish to but it's not going to gain much traction without amplification. Marketing via email is a great way of amplifying content , but it can only reach those in your marketing list. Social media can help you increase the reach of your content. If you post your content to your followers, they'll spread it to their own followers if they find it helpful. These people will then also share it with their friends, further increasing your reach. You'll also get relevant traffic as well as inbound linking social signals, inbound linking, and brand recognition All of which are used by search engines to determine content assessment of quality.

4.) Brand Recognition and Signals
Search engines can use brand identity and awareness to determine the credibility of your website and how trustworthy it must be for their ranking algorithms. Social media aids in building brand awareness and amplifies the content you publish. Google refers to this as co-citation. These co-citations can be developed through social media , which can help improve Google's trust and assist with the search engine's branded searches.
